Output d386030c50df69ca5ea837cbd5e8b1373194fcef0779f5680046a776d3402a9f:1

value
301895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4acc13551f9677de2eec23bc1fde1540144283 OP_EQUAL
address
3MbEqMuYwWch51WmmXzoxSH9zVBVq5v7sh
transaction
d386030c50df69ca5ea837cbd5e8b1373194fcef0779f5680046a776d3402a9f
spent
true